Christians should strive to be like the net in today’s gospel, gathering all persons without discrimination and without judgment. We should take in persons of “all kinds” in order to build up the Kingdom of God. Let us act as the net does, not letting the smallest or weakest in our world be left behind. The wicked and the righteous both belong in the net if the Kingdom of God is to be realized and lived.

Let us pray that we live inspired by the net and know that the time for God’s justice will come later. Who in our communities or “nets” can we learn to love or include…no matter what?
